ORT: Open Venue for International Exams Administration

Last Friday 20th, November, the administration of the Cambridge-ESOL international exams started. Our School, for the first time, was the open venue to the community. Approximately 120 ORT School students were involved and other schools sat for the exam in our premises.

ORT Schools prepare their students for the Cambridge-ESOL examinations. After that, they take a computer-based test, since it complies with the technological standards requested.

ORT Schools have incorporated Cambridge-ESOL exams to the English curriculum so as to offer students better training, to promote the study of the language, to facilitate the access to superior education and to motivate students to get more confident in their ability to use English successfully.

The exams cover the different levels of knowledge in English and our students have been prepared all the year round with material specially designed by the schools, and in all the linguistic skills: Listening, Speaking, Reading and Writing.

Cultural Exchange with a British Adolescent

Within the framework of the programme “Talking with Natives” –organised by the English Department, David Romain, an adolescent from Great Britain, visited us last Wednesday 4th, November.

“Talking with Natives” is a space where we invite different English-speaking people so as to give our students the chance to listen and practice the language with people with different accents and intonations.

The subject was “Cultural Exchange”, and David told us about his life in England as a kid and as an adolescent, about schools in the UK, what adolescents do during the weekend, etc.

During the meeting, the students were very enthusiastic and asked questions to David, apart from telling him their own experiences.

This type of activities stimulates our students to make an effort to master the English language.

Workshop on Entrepreneurship Management for Visually and Hearing-Impaired People

Today, students and teachers from the Business Administration track, Belgrano campus, have initiated a workshop on Entrepreneurship Management for visually and hearing-impaired people.

The project is carried out along with AUDELA, a non-profit civil association, which develops programmes to raise awareness and promote social integration of people with disabilities.

The workshop will take 6 weeks, and it will include contents on accounting, marketing, human resources and law among others. The classes will be delivered by teachers and students of the track with teaching materials developed in the school.

“HP Innovation in Education” Grant

In August, Hewlett Packard gave ORT Technical Schools an award for winning the “HP Innovation in Education” grant. The winning project incorporated the new educational technologies to improve the teaching and learning of Mathematics, and it was developed by the Teaching & Learning Resources Centre (“CREA”), along with the Mathematics Department and Technological Education Area.

The award consists of an HP Mobile Digital Classroom (estimated in U$S 70,000), which contains resources such as Mini Note PCs, Digital Boards and Tablet PCs.

This new computing equipment will be incorporated into the classrooms and laboratories in September, thus increasing the amount and variety of technological resources with which our students will learn, and contributing to the continuous improvement of the educational quality of our institution.

It is important to stand out that this is the 2nd time that Hewlett Packard grants such an award to our institution. In July 2007, ORT Technical Schools obtained the “Technology for Teaching Higher Education” grant, thanks to a project developed by the CREA and the Technological Education Area. The grant enabled the implementation of an educational research project based on the application of mobile technologies to the classrooms. 30 teachers and more than 1600 students are involved in this project, which will continue till the end of 2009.

National Day of Memory for Truth and Justice

The 3rd-year Coordination Department has been carrying out different activities to commemorate the National Day of Memory for Truth and Justice. Among them, a meeting with Tatiana Sfiligoy -the first granddaughter found by Abuelas de Plaza de Mayo- was organized. Tatiana told her story and answered the students’ questions.

We would like to share with you a text by Eduardo Galeano, which was read during the activity:

Does history repeat? Or does it repeat as a punishment to those who are incapable of listening to it? There is no dumb history. No matter how much they burn it, or break it, or lie about it, human history refuses to shut up. The right to recall does not appear among the human rights established by the United Nations, but today it is vital to vindicate it and put it into practice: not so as to repeat the past, but to prevent it from repeating; not so that we -who are alive- become ventriloquists of those who are dead, but to be able to speak aloud without being condemned to the perpetual eco of stupidity and disgrace. When the memory is truly alive, it is in the air we breathe, and memory, from the air, breathes us.
